What does your assistant do while you are 'on holiday'?

An issue related to assistant manager's inactivity has been observed
We have had a few news on Football Manager 2011 recently, but now we take a look at an issue the users from SI forums had encountered with the job that an assistant manager does. Ever wondered what your assistant does while you are 'on holiday'?

Having a good professional in a club's staff is priceless. However, it is often the case in Football Manager, especially at the beginning of a career, that the managers do not quite trust their assistants. It is the reason why the managers, before going on holiday, tell their assistants to stick the original game plan. Some managers finally lean towards giving the assistant more control over a team. It should be easy then to determine the true managerial abilities of the assistant. In fact, though, it is not so obvious as it may seem. A user from Sports Interactive Forums decided to give a full control of a team to their assistant and did not tell him to stick to the current team's tactics. However, as it turned out, the formation was never changed and the tactics remained the same. Curiously enough, the scenario was the same even if such absurd formations were used as 10-0-0. The assistant did not care when an opponent had 50 shoots on target during a match either. A comment concerning this matter has been made by Neil Brock - he said (perhaps a little enigmatically) there may be some troubles when such absurd formations are used. Another reason may be the assistant's good judgement as he decided to stick to the tactics that were successfully used before. The experiences with an assistant manager looks a bit of buggy though, and they seem to deprecate a little the value of an assistant manager. Fortunately, Neil Brock assured the FM fans the issue has been already investigated by the relevant people, and the problem should not occur in the upcoming FM release.
